4 changes: 4 additions & 0 deletions changelog/187.bugfix.rst
Original file line number Diff line number Diff line change
@@ -0,0 +1,4 @@
Fix metadata key mismatch between ``SpectrogramFactory`` and ``RFSSpectrogram``.
The factory stored CDF global attributes under ``"cdf_globals"`` but ``RFSSpectrogram.level``
and ``RFSSpectrogram.version`` expected ``"cdf_meta"``, causing a ``KeyError`` when accessing
these properties on spectrograms created from real CDF files.
